How To Keep Cheese Fresh

Food And Drink : Starters

There is nothing more annoying than going to have a slice of your favourite cheese only to see that, despite being well in date on the packet, it has a rather nasty set of mould growing on it, often green splurgey mould.

Given this then many would throw it away but rememebr that you should actually try to STOP it getting mouldy in the first place so you don't HAVE to bin it!

In order to achieve this aim simply protect the cheese from the rest of the contents of the fridge by storing it in a sandwich bag, preferably a sealable one or at least one that you can wrap around it.
